I use a Minolta x700 which isn't terribly old, but mine is pre-autofocus. I really like using it even though I still have a lot to learn. The one thing about digital vs. 35mm that I miss is the instant gratfication of digital photography.
Something that I did since I didn't get a manual when I got the camera was to download it off the Internet. If you can't find your copy, you might try searching for it.
When I take pictures, I try to keep a record of how I take the shots, so I can compare what does what to the final product. I also like to take more than one of the same shot since it is a learning experience for me and I don't really know what I am doing.
ETA: That does get expensive, especially when I use slide film (my dad gave me some slide film recently) but I think it is worth it.
